Transaction 5740defa8280eca19f0457a74c020892877f50afba7ed348a4552fb3683774a0

1 Input
2 Outputs
  • 5740defa8280eca19f0457a74c020892877f50afba7ed348a4552fb3683774a0:0
  • value  25000000
    address  1EkUs9mA78sZhoBGoLBr4R3CmGJAveWmzv
  • 5740defa8280eca19f0457a74c020892877f50afba7ed348a4552fb3683774a0:1
  • value  75890000
    address  1CAfnD9JnyBxhm2qkLju3gWtyyNchXSjA1